Shannon Heith Pierce

Shannon Heith Pierce
March 4, 1982 ~ October 4, 2022

Shannon Heith Pierce, 40 year old Mooreland resident, passed away Tuesday, October 4, 2022 in Jay, Oklahoma. Graveside services will be held at 11:00 a.m. Saturday, October 22, 2022 at the Debolt Cemetery in Arnett, Oklahoma with Reverend Micah Welcher officiating.

Shannon Heith Pierce was born on March 4, 1982 in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ma to Troy Don Pierce and Jonna Sue (Martin) Hensley. Shannon was lovingly known to his family and most friends as Heith. He attended school at Arnett and Mooreland and later obtained his G.E.D.

Heith worked in housing construction, as an auto mechanic, but worked mostly in the oilfield. He was a talented artist and could draw just about anything. Heith had a big heart and was always willing to help those in need.

He is survived by his mother, Jonna Hensley and husband Chris of Mooreland; father, Troy Pierce of Moore; two daughters, Sky Eckenrode and Savannah Pierce; sisters: Shanell Hensley of Mooreland, Kensey Hudson of Claremore, Rae Mumford of Moore, and Beth Brinkley of Claremore; one brother, Seth Pierce of Rockwall, Texas; and a host of other relatives and friends.

Heith was preceded in death by an infant brother, Troy James Pierce; maternal grandparents, Clarence and Donnetia Martin; paternal grandmother, Jackie Claycomb; and uncle, Jimmy Pierce.

Memorial contributions may be made to the Oklahoma Medical Research Foundation, Mental Health research with the funeral home accepting the contributions.
